Technical problems? Need help sorting out your project? Check out our service options below

tech support for roof drains sump pans

We Have Excellent Tech Support Staff Ready To Answer Your Questions

  • Visit our installation, blog or FAQ pages for more technical info
  • Call and speak to our trained techs. 
  • Review our videos on our YouTube channel. 
  • M – F, 8 am to 5 pm, PST Calif USA. 
  • Review our service options

(949) 297-8689